Connected Cities Make It Further

My list

Technology is a critical foundation to advance safer and more sustainable and innovative cities globally. As new digital opportunities continue to advance, with computing power expanding, 5G being rolled out with 6G on the horizon, how can cities push to work on innovation focused on people and sustainability? How can datafication, blockchain, quantum computing, extended reality, and digital twins, among other developments, inspire better cities?
